* fix(sessions): keep a shared chat directory until its last session is deleted
Deleting a root chat session removed its managed scratch directory even
when forks, side threads, or subagents still lived in it; OpenCode then
failed every prompt in those sessions with FileSystem.realPath NotFound.
The directory is now removed only once no other known session resolves
to it. The deleted subtree does not count, because the server cascade-
deletes it, and an unloaded global cache keeps the directory instead of
guessing.

* fix(sessions): relocate a session whose worktree directory disappeared
A worktree removed outside OpenChamber, by the agent or by hand, left its
sessions pointed at a path that no longer exists: every terminal create
and restart failed with "Invalid working directory" and the tab stayed
stuck, while Git, Files, and prompts kept targeting the dead path.
The terminal server now names that one rejection (TERMINAL_CWD_MISSING)
instead of substituting a directory of its own. The shared UI reuses the
archived-restore fallback for live sessions: a server-confirmed missing
directory moves the session and its stranded subtree to the project's
primary directory through the control-plane move, clears the worktree
hint, re-selects the session, and tells the user where it went. It runs
from a terminal failure and on activation of any session whose directory
is neither a project root nor a managed chat directory; available,
unknown, and failed probes leave everything untouched.

* fix(scripts): make oc-dev load again after the changelog cleanup
The changelog cleanup referenced fs.existsSync in a module that imports
existsSync by name and never binds fs, so every oc-dev invocation failed
with "fs is not defined" before reaching its action.
* fix(sessions): probe directory availability on disk, not through OpenCode path resolution
OpenCode's /path never checks that a directory exists: it echoes the
requested path and resolves its project through Git discovery that
swallows errors, so a deleted worktree came back as a valid location and
every missing-directory fallback (draft recovery, archived restore,
session relocation) stayed inert on a real server. The probe now asks
OpenChamber's own /api/fs/list, which stats the path and reports
not-found and not-directory explicitly; anything else stays unknown.
* fix(sidebar): keep a worktree whose directory is gone visible as missing
git keeps a worktree registered after its directory is deleted outside
git and marks it prunable; the list parser ignored that line, so a
deleted worktree looked alive, and nothing in the app asked for a new
listing anyway. The server now reports prunable, the UI keeps such a
worktree in the topology with worktreeStatus missing and a warning icon
on its sidebar group, and relocating a session out of a confirmed-
missing directory raises an in-app topology signal the sidebar
rediscovers on. Dropping the worktree instead would hide every session
that lived there, and a hidden session can never be opened or relocated.
No idle polling is added.
* fix(sessions): never relocate a session to the filesystem root
OpenCode files a directory outside any Git repository under its global
project, whose worktree is the filesystem root. A managed chat whose
directory vanished would otherwise be moved to /. The relocation now
refuses a root destination, and the activation probe recognizes chat
directories through the home-based check as well, so it does not depend
on the chats root having been resolved yet.

The tab list lived only in per-tab sessionStorage, so a new browser
tab, another device, or cleared storage showed an empty terminal
sidebar while PTYs kept running server-side, and orphans leaked until
the idle sweep. Add GET /api/terminal/sessions and adopt unknown
server sessions into the local tab projection (additive only; a failed
listing changes nothing).
The idle sweep also reaped terminals in background tabs because only
the active tab holds a WebSocket attachment. Add POST
/api/terminal/touch and have open clients periodically refresh
activity for every session their tabs reference.

Terminal creation no longer waits for the Ghostty viewport to report its
size: it starts the PTY immediately with a container/font-derived
provisional size (falling back to 80x24), then resizes once the real
viewport dimensions are known, with a dedupe guard while sizing settles.
Starting the shell earlier means it can emit device/theme queries before
a browser terminal is attached to answer them, so the server now answers
primary device attribute queries itself (Fish blocks ~10s on this at
startup) and bun-pty buffers output emitted before a data subscriber
attaches. Also fixes a few WebSocket transport reconnect races surfaced
by session creation now overlapping renderer setup.
bun-pty merges the OS environ into PTY children, so deleting ARGV0 from the
JS env object alone left the AppImage path in the shell. Wrap Linux PTY
spawns with env -u ARGV0, clear native ARGV0 under Bun via libc unsetenv,
and always clear process.env even when no login-shell snapshot exists.

AppImage exports ARGV0 into the process environment. zsh treats that as
argv[0] for every external command, which broke Python venv detection in
the integrated terminal and managed OpenCode sessions.
Clear ARGV0 in Electron before login-shell probing, refuse to re-apply it
from shell snapshots, and strip it from terminal PTY and managed OpenCode
launch environments.

Replace the legacy terminal flow with a shared authenticated WebSocket
runtime used across web, desktop, relay, and mobile surfaces.
- introduce the v3 terminal protocol with scoped attachments, snapshots,
ordered output, bounded replay history, reconnects, and explicit lifecycle
- harden PTY creation, restart, resize, close, force-kill, idle cleanup,
shell selection, login mode, environment sanitization, and appearance sync
- add runtime-aware terminal APIs with relay authentication and Electron parity
- add a fullscreen mobile terminal workspace with touch scrolling,
long-press selection, safe-area controls, quick keys, and Ctrl/Alt input
- add terminal selection attachments, preview detection, project actions,
shell settings, and localized UI
- harden Ghostty rendering, resize recovery, Unicode handling, block
characters, line height, and stale-row behavior
- remove the obsolete terminal SSE path and update reverse-proxy guidance
- expand terminal runtime, transport, input, selection, and store coverage
- avoid duplicate web builds when preparing mobile assets in root CI builds
